#dbdb5f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dbdb5f is composed of 85.9% red, 85.9%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.6%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 63.3% and a lightness of 61.6%. #dbdb5f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ffbe with #b7b700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#dbdb5f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dbdb5f has RGB values of R:219, G:219,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14408543.

Shades and Tints of #dbdb5f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fbfbef is the lightest one.
